Handover note — Crumbwheel order cutoffs.

Welcome aboard. The bakery cutoff rule in Crumbwheel closes same-day orders at 14:00 local to each storefront, not UTC — this has bitten us twice. Holiday overrides live in the calendar service and take precedence silently, so always check there first when a cutoff looks wrong. To unlock the calendar service's admin console after a restart, enter the recovery passphrase below.

vault phrase of bagap-bahaf = silion-pelox-sorox-casdor-quenwyn-fraax-eliox-praael-kelion-quenvan-kasox-rusael-norius-belvan

Team,

The humidity sensors in the Verdella GH-4 controller have been drifting ~3% per week since the firmware bump. Root cause: calibration table was loaded before the ADC warmed up. Fix reorders init and adds a 30s settle window.

For the new contractor: don't touch the calibration constants in growthcore/cal.c — they're per-batch and regenerated at the factory. If a unit still drifts after this build, escalate to the Pelton Ridge bench team.

Rollout starts 02:00. The build token for tonight's release is below.

build token for kagaf-hahof: htk14_9d3d4d26d7d8de

Changelog — Wireloom v3.2.4

Hi support team! Two things in this one. First, the websocket reconnect bug is finally squashed — clients no longer spiral into a reconnect storm after network blips, so expect fewer "app keeps dropping" tickets. Second, we rotated our release signing key, so customers pinning the old key will see install warnings until they update their trust config. Point them to the docs, and share the new key when asked:

release key, yagap-kagag: bky6_1ks93y

Subject: Cut-over summary — Fennick resolver migration

Team, ahead of the weekly sync: the cut-over from the legacy Fennick resolvers to the new Thornquist pair completed Tuesday night. The flaky DNS resolution in the Oslett zone was traced to an aggressive negative-cache TTL combined with a misbehaving upstream forwarder. Both are fixed. Error rates dropped from roughly 2% to effectively zero. For the record and for anyone paging through later, the resolver configuration we landed on is below.

settings of yahag-yafog:
[pramir]
host = pramir.qirvancorp.internal
user = pramir_svc
database = pramir_prod